A certain transition to H spectrum from an excited state to ground state in one or more steps gives rise to total `10` lines .How many of these belong to UV spectrum ?

A

`2`

B

`3`

C

`4`

D

`5`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
C

`10` lines are obtained as a result of elctronic transition from `5^(th)` level to lower levels and lines corresponding to `UV` spectrum are as followos :
`5 rarr 1, 4 rarr 1, 3 rarr 1, 2 rarr 1`
